[Global Witness] New Global Witness figures bring the total killed and disappeared since 2012 to 2,375 Just two South American countries - Colombia and Brazil - accounted for 52% of the 2025 killings In Asia, defenders are facing a rising tide of criminalisation and intimidation Globally, more than three quarters of those killed were small-scale farmers, Indigenous Peoples or Afro-descendant peoples.
